After your software is installed you'll need to configure it to connect to your TCD account. It's important to note that this also requires us to turn the service on for your account. If you would like the service turned on just add a comment to this post and we'll take care of it for you.
Once Writer is installed and started you will be asked if you already have a Blog or if you need to set one up. Select "I already have a weblog set up"
Next you will be asked to choose your Weblog Type. Select "Another weblog service"
The next screen will have you populate your credentials. The weblog Homepage URL is http://www.thechurchdoor.com. Add your username and password.
Choose Metaweblog API as your Provider with http://www.thechurchdoor.com/desktopmodules/digmeta/meta.ashx as the "Remote posting URL" and select "Next". Live Writer will now connect to TheChurchDoor.com and retrieve your editable space(s)
Select the weblog of your choice, there will probably be only one listed, "TCD Blog - Your Name"
You will then be asked if you wish to create a temporary post so Writer can detect your themes. Select "No"
Your Done! Select "Finish" and Live Writer will open up and your ready to add content.
